Sharsān Amīr Kūh
Sharsān Amīr Kūh is a hill in South Khorasan Province, Iran and has an elevation of 2,385 metres. Sharsān Amīr Kūh is situated nearby to the locality Kūh-e Moḩammad Ḩoseyn-e ‘Abedī, as well as near Manāvand.Places in the Area

Menavand
Village
Manavand is a village in Qohestan Rural District, Qohestan District, Darmian County, South Khorasan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 123, in 43 families. Menavand is situated 3½ km east of Sharsān Amīr Kūh.
Now Qand
Village

Now Qand is a village in Qohestan Rural District, Qohestan District, Darmian County, South Khorasan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 150, in 56 families. Now Qand is situated 5 km east of Sharsān Amīr Kūh.
Sarqan-e Sofla
Hamlet
Sarqan-e Sofla is a village in Shakhen Rural District, in the Central District of Birjand County, South Khorasan Province, Iran. At the 2016 census, its population was 21, in 8 families. Sarqan-e Sofla is situated 5 km northwest of Sharsān Amīr Kūh.
